OMV Launches 10MW Green Hydrogen Plant at Schwechat Refinery

OMV, the state-owned Austrian energy and chemicals company, has launched a 10MW green hydrogen production plant at the Schwechat refinery near Vienna. This facility, costing €25 million, has the capacity to produce 1,500 tonnes of green hydrogen per year, equivalent to around 4 tonnes per day. The plant utilizes a 10MW PEM electrolyser powered by renewable sources such as wind, hydro, and solar energy. OMV, with a target of achieving Net Zero by 2050 'at the latest', also announced that the plant is certified for producing renewable fuels of non-biological origin. The green hydrogen generated will be utilized for the production of sustainable aviation fuels and renewable diesel, contributing to decarbonizing processes at the Schwechat site. Martijn van Koten, OMV Board Member Fuels & Feedstock and Chemicals, highlighted the significance of establishing local green hydrogen production and supply chains in Europe to advance climate objectives while ensuring industrial development. Austria has set ambitious goals to install 1GW of electrolyser capacity by 2030 and replace 80% of fossil-based hydrogen in energy-intensive industries within the same timeframe. This initiative by OMV aligns with Austria's commitment to transitioning towards green hydrogen and reducing carbon emissions in industrial sectors.
